ODE TO SUPER BILLY KEE
I AM delighted to be sponsoring Super Billy Kee (home shirt) once again this coming season, and as the world’s finest Football Poet Laureate I attach a new poem in honour of Stanley’s #29. Sharon Wilkie-Jones Poet in Residence Bolton Sixth Form College
Stryker, Stryker burning bright
Upon the pitch beneath floodlight
What immortal football boot
Dare frame thy fearful aim to shoot
In what jinking runs aspired
And scorched the wings from side to side
Would tremble those with boots of clay
And turned to dust amidst decay
When the Sky dropped down to sea
The grace and beauty that is he
What the soul of youth that fired
The blazing heart transfixed desire
What the draw the win the loss
What the match of
human cost
That twist the sinews of each heart
The alchemy of football art
And when the game is all but done
The players walk off one by one
What then the child within the soul
That dreams to score the winning goal
Stryker, Stryker burning bright
Upon the pitch beneath floodlight
What immortal football boot
Dare frame thy fearful aim to shoot.
